Abstract

A method and system for autonomous channel coordination for a wireless distribution system (WDS) are disclosed. A wireless communication system includes a plurality of access points (APs) and the APs communicate each other via a WDS. A coordinated channel group (CCG) of a plurality of member APs is established. The member APs of the CCG camp on a WDS channel used for the WDS among the member APs of the CCG. One AP among the member APs of the CCG is designated as a master AP. The master AP coordinates with other member APs of the CCG for selecting and configuring the WDS channel for the CCG and addition and deletion of member APs. By allowing APs to define a CCG, changes of the WDS channel are performed autonomously while maintaining connectivity.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. In a wireless communication system including a plurality of access points (APs) wherein the APs communicate each other via a wireless distribution system (WDS), a method for autonomous channel coordination for the WDS, the method comprising:
 establishing a coordinated channel group (CCG) comprising a plurality of member APs, the member APs of the CCG camping on a WDS channel used for the WDS among the member APs of the CCG;   designating one AP among the member APs of the CCG as a master AP; and   the master AP coordinating with other member APs of the CCG for selecting and configuring the WDS channel for the CCG.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1  wherein each member AP of the CCG broadcasts a CCG indicator (CCGI) on the WDS channel.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2  wherein the CCGI is transmitted via one of a beacon frame and a probe response frame.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 2  wherein the CCGI is transmitted via a stand alone frame.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 2  wherein the master AP transmits a master indicator associated with the CCGI.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1  further comprising:
 a non-member AP that desires to join the CCG sending a CCG addition request message to the master AP; 
 the master AP determining whether or not accept the non-member AP; and 
 the master AP sending a CCG addition response message to the non-member AP, the CCG addition response message indicating an accept or a reject for the request. 
 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6  wherein the CCG addition request message includes capability information of the non-member AP.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 7  wherein the capability information includes at least one of a list of frequency channels that the non-member AP may support, information as to whether the non-member AP is capable of reporting channel utilization and interference measurement, and information related to a basic service set (BSS) served by the non-member AP.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 6  wherein the CCG addition request message is included in one of a probe request message and an association request message.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 6  wherein the CCG addition response message is included in one of a probe response message and an association response message.
